Dolf Luque, 1922, Cincinnati. A workhorse's workhorse — 261 innings, 18 complete games, a 3.31 E.R.A. stingy enough to hang your hat on. The wins never came; 13 and 23 don't tell the story a man's arm was writing all summer. Some pitchers get the breaks; Luque got the quiet bats behind him, and he kept taking the ball anyway.
